The best way to measure the mass of a pair of glasses is to use a digital scale that can provide an accurate reading in grams. Place the glasses gently on the scale's platform to avoid any damage or misreading. Ensure the scale is calibrated and zeroed before measuring for the most accurate result. This method is preferable as it yields precise measurements quickly and easily.

Common methods for accurate mass measurements in scientific research include using analytical balances, mass spectrometry, and gravimetric analysis. These techniques allow researchers to precisely measure the mass of substances with high accuracy and reliability.
The molar mass symbol in chemistry calculations is significant because it represents the mass of one mole of a substance in grams. It is used to convert between the mass of a substance and the number of moles present, allowing for accurate measurements and calculations in chemical reactions and stoichiometry.
